Block 31 on the CMS-1500 form requires which of the following?

Explanation:
Block 31 is where the physician or supplier signs to certify that the information on the claim is true and that the services were provided as billed. This attestation is the provider’s formal authorization that the claim is accurate, which payers require before processing. The signature links the claim to the provider’s responsibility for the submitted data. The date of service is recorded in other parts of the form, and items like a patient’s email or the policy number belong in other blocks, so Block 31 specifically serves as the provider’s certified approval of the claim.
